What i do is look around in smithing forums for companies that trade coal, iron, and usually a little pay for the equivalent number of bars. Usually something like 1k iron, 2k coal, and 50-100k gp for 1k steel bars. Its the best and least painful exp i know, plus u make a decent profit. Only downside is you have to get the starting materials yourself.
